Vince Samios - Internet Entrepreneur

Internet Marketing at Search Engine Optimization Consultant - Mula sa Sky sa Earth at ang eter ng Web
Bago: Makipag-ugnayan sa Form

Previous Post: Screenflow PC (bintana) kung-paano na Next Post: Halaga ng SEO Traffic vs Halaga ng PPC Trapiko

Makipag-ugnayan sa Form 7 IP Address, Date / Time at URL ng Pahina

Siguraduhin upang makakuha ng FREE DIY SEO link pakete Vince's Links
Gayundin ... sundin ako sa kaba

Sa isang nakaraang post ko wrote tungkol sa pagdadagdag ng patlang ng IP address sa Makipag-ugnayan sa Form 7 1.9.3

Simula noon nagkaroon ng major update sa Makipag-ugnayan sa Form 7, na nagbibigay ng paunang kung-paano na mali-mali.

Kabutihang-palad - sa mga pinakabagong update Makipag-ugnayan sa Form 7 ay nagdagdag ng bagong tag na [wpcf7.remote_ip] na kung saan ay pumapalit sa pagdagdag ng mga IP bahagi ng aking mga tutorial.

Dalawang mga function na kung saan ay hindi naidagdag at ngayon na walang-trabaho na sa aking mga lumang kung-paano na ang pagdagdag ng petsa at oras upang Makipag-ugnayan sa Form 7, at ang pagdaragdag ng Source ang Pahina sa Makipag-ugnayan sa Form 7.

Ang function para sa pagdaragdag ng source na pahina ay pa rin ang parehong:

function curPageURL() {
$pageURL = 'http';
if ($_SERVER["HTTPS"] == “on”) {$pageURL .= “s”;}
$pageURL .= “://”;
if ($_SERVER["SERVER_PORT"] != “80″) {
$pageURL .= $_SERVER["SERVER_NAME"].”:”.$_SERVER["SERVER_PORT"].$_SERVER["REQUEST_URI"];
} else {
$pageURL .= $_SERVER["SERVER_NAME"].$_SERVER["REQUEST_URI"];
}
return $pageURL;
}

Subalit oras na ito, idagdag ito sa ilalim ng kasama / classes.php file, bago ang huling "?>"

Next, sa parehong file (kasama / classes.php) sa paghahanap para sa mga linyang ito:

$enctype = apply_filters( 'wpcf7_form_enctype', '' );

Direkta sa ibaba ang linyang ito, idagdag ang sumusunod na code:

$curpageurl = curpageurl();
date_default_timezone_set('GMT');
$timedate = date('l jS \of FY h:i:s A');

Ngayon, sa paghahanap para sa mga linyang ito:

. esc_attr( WPCF7_VERSION ) . '" />' . "\n";

Sa ibaba na kung saan kailangan mong magdagdag ng isang linya at isingit ang mga sumusunod na code:

$form .= '<input type="hidden" name="time-date" value="' . $timedate . '" />';
$form .= '<input type="hidden" name="page-url" value="' . $curpageurl . '" />';

Ang susunod na hakbang - ang pagpapadala ng aktwal na mga halaga ng gamit ang form, ay pa rin ng misteryo ...

Kung check mo ang form sa code sa matapos gumawa ng mga pagbabago na ito makikita mo ang source ng pahina at oras / mga variable ng petsa na ipinapakita ... ngunit hindi sila magpadala sa email ...

Kung ikaw ay nagtrabaho ito, paki-puna sa ibaba.

Tags:

Posted in Internet Marketing at Paragliding at Travels 4 na buwan, 3 linggo nakaraan at 5:40.

1 comment

Isa Reply

  1. nice tip :) ay naghahanap na ito thanks


Iwanan ng isang Sumagot